John Reilley was transported on the Prince Regent, departing 13th Feb 1824 and arriving 15th Jul 1824 with 180 passengers.
Prince Regent, 1820-21. On Tuesday arrived from Ireland, the ship Prince Regent, Captain Clifford. She left the Cove of Cork the 19th of September last, and brings, in excellent health, 144 male prisoners. Surgeon Superintendent, Dr. Taylor, R. N. The guard comprises 30 men of the 1st Foot (Royals), under orders of Lieut. Lewis. Sydney Gazette, 13 Jan 1821.

Convict Notes




Irish Convict Database by Peter Mayberry. John Reilley, alias Reilly, Riley, age on arrival, 33, Prince Regent I (2) 1824, Tried 1823 at Meath, Life, DOB, 1791, Native place, Meath, Thatcher ploughman. ---------------------------------------------------- Colonial Secretary Index. RILEY, John. Per "Prince Regent", 1824. 1824 Jul 21 On list of convicts landed from the "Prince Regent" and forwarded to Bringelly for distribution; listed as Reilly (Reel 6013; 4/3512 p.2) 1824 Nov 20; 1825 Jul 30 On list of convicts maintained by John Wood (Fiche 3117; 4/1840A No.1074 p.357; Fiche 3119; 4/1840B No.26 p.175) 1825 Apr 28 Employed by John Wood (Fiche 3145; 4/1843A No.550 p.565) --------------------------------------------------- 1828 Census Index. John Riley, age 45, Prince Regent, 1824, Life, Bullock driver to John Wood, Cox’s River, Bringelly. -------------------------------------------------- Convicts index, 1791-1873. John Reilley, Prince Regent 1824, Ticket of Leave, 34/1190. District, Bathurst; Born, Dublin; Trade, Labourer; Tried, Meath. John Rielly, Prince Regent 1824, Conditional Pardon, 1 Jan 1842. 43/097.
